Couples Therapy
Success in couples therapy looks like reestablishing a sense of connectedness, facilitating more open and vulnerable communication, and fostering feelings of mutual support and appreciation.
I am trained in Integrative Behavioral Couples Therapy (IBCT). Rigorous studies with couples experiencing relationship distress, communication issues, and difficulties connecting with each other have demonstrated the effectiveness of IBCT. This approach is easily tailored to the specific issues each couple brings to therapy.
Areas of expertise in couples therapy include couples navigating infertility, parenting differences, and LGBTQ+ couples.
Course of Therapy
We typically begin with a free 15-minute consultation appointment. This is an opportunity to discuss what brings you (or y’all) to therapy and your treatment goals, and for both parties to assess whether it feels like a good fit to work together. The consultation appointment also allows me to ensure that I am equipped to address your problems and help you work toward your treatment goals. Ethically, I am obligated to inform you if your presenting concerns or goals are outside of the scope of my training and expertise and I will do my best to offer a recommendation or referral as needed.
After the initial consultation appointment, I typically begin meeting with clients for weekly 50-minute individual therapy sessions or 60-minute couples sessions. I find that a weekly cadence helps build rapport, establish momentum, and facilitate early treatment gains. Some people benefit from meeting weekly for the entirety of treatment while others might drop down to meeting every other week before wrapping up.
The duration of therapy varies significantly based on the nature and complexity of the concerns we are addressing. When issues are more recent, clearly defined, and limited in scope, clients often experience meaningful gains within a few months. In contrast, longstanding or more complex challenges may require a longer-term approach, potentially extending over a year or more. As with all aspects of the therapeutic process, the length of treatment is determined collaboratively, and tailored to each client or couple’s unique needs and goals.

Fees
My fee is $220 for a 55 minute individual therapy session and $250 for a 60 minute couples therapy session. As an Out-of-Network provider, I prioritize your confidentiality, privacy, and personalized care. By choosing not to contract directly with insurance companies, I can focus fully on delivering therapy tailored to your unique needs, without the limitations or restrictions often imposed by insurance plans. This approach allows us to make decisions together that align with your goals, rather than adhering to pre-defined insurance protocols. Additionally, this ensures the highest level of privacy, as your therapy records will not be shared with insurance companies. Should you choose to seek reimbursement from your health plan, while I do not bill insurance companies directly, I will happily provide you with a “superbill” that you can submit for reimbursement or to file towards your deductible. Therapy services are typically health savings account (HSA) and Flexible Spending Account (FSA) eligible.
